// Max depth of the undo/redo stack in Sketchloom's canvas editor.
// Security note: each entry snapshots the full document model, so an
// unbounded stack is a memory-exhaustion vector from a hostile plugin
// spamming mutations. We cap it hard and evict oldest-first. Chosen
// after load tests on oversized diagrams; see the build referenced below.

pipeline stamp: htk31_f769b577b3028a4e9958e5bb8d1259a

Approvals: Bloom Filter for the Kestrelvault KV Store

The Mistgate bloom filter sits in front of Kestrelvault to cut lookup misses. Support team: do not approve filter resizes or false-positive-rate changes yourselves. Rebuilds require a change ticket and run off-peak only; expect elevated read latency during rebuilds. Disabling the filter is an emergency action and needs written sign-off. All approval requests must be routed to the approver named below.

named custodian: Brivan Eliath Quenox Frador

Prepared for the incoming director. Following the mid-year review, Arbelo Goods will reduce the marketing budget by roughly fourteen percent for the coming fiscal year. The cut falls mainly on trade-show participation and print placements; digital campaigns for the Fenwick line are preserved at current levels. The Ostrand regional office absorbs the largest share of the reduction. Savings will be redirected per the direction set by the steering committee. The underlying rationale is set out in the confidential note below.

board note of kafog-bajep: Briathek Partners is in early talks to buy Aldaelek Group for about $47.1 million. The Ulaath launch date is September 4, and nothing goes to the press before then.